100-150m routes on good quality quartzite. The Cicerone guide described the Tizgut Gorge as two separate crags (Crag S and Crag R), but both are now commonly referred to simply as the Tizgut Gorge.
Go through the village of Tizgut and park at the end of the road. Tizgut gorge will be visible up and right. Take a vague path to the water course, then follow the river bed into the gorge.
